July 20, 2026 Opinion or Order Filing 34 ORAL ORDER: The Court, having reviewed Plaintiffs motion for appointment of counsel (Motion), (D.I. #8 ), hereby ORDERS that the Motion is DENIED without prejudice to renew at a later stage in the case. A pro se plaintiff in a civil action has no constitutional or statutory right to counsel. See Parham v. Johnson, 126 F.3d 454, 456-57 (3d Cir. 1997). The Court can determine, in its discretion, whether the appointment of counsel is warranted based on the circumstances presented in that particular case. 28 U.S.C. 1915(e)(1). Here, the Court has reviewed several non-exhaustive factors that the United States Court of Appeals for the Third Circuit has indicated may be relevant to this type of request for counsel, see Montgomery v. Pinchak, 294 F.3d 492, 499 (3d Cir. 2002); Tabron v. Grace, 6 F.3d 147, 155-57 (3d Cir. 1993), and after doing so, it declines to appoint Plaintiff counsel at this time. The Court does so because: (1) this case does not involve unduly complex legal issues; (2) Plaintiff, in light of the nature and content of his filings so far in the case, has demonstrated a sufficient ability to represent himself (including the ability to obtain access to writing materials and to make filings with the Court); and (3) the Court is mindful of the need to use the resource of volunteer attorney time judiciously. See id. The Motion does not show a likelihood of substantial prejudice, warranting exercise of this Courts discretionary power to appoint counsel. See Tabron, 6 F.3d at 154.
